Why does sun glow?

SCIENCE FACTS(Sun)

The Sun is the star at the center of the Solar System and composed of helium and hydrogen.Sunlight is the main source of energy for life on earth.Nuclear fusion at the core of the Sun produces an appreciable amount of thermal energy that makes the Sun glow.The interior of the Sun is radiative and nuclear fusion in the inner portions of the Sun has modified the composition by converting hydrogen into helium.The reactive core zone where hydrogen is converted into helium, is starting to surround the core of helium ash.This will continue and cause the sun to become red giant.This nuclear fusions produce thermal energy and that same energy reaches us as heat and light.Sunlight is mainly composed of infrared light,visible light and ultraviolet light.
